Transaction 63a76a570bc9fd21a923eaba85b3a3d97d1173bbfe62fbeea16c773222bfe64f

2 Input
2 Outputs
  • 63a76a570bc9fd21a923eaba85b3a3d97d1173bbfe62fbeea16c773222bfe64f:0
  • value  5000000
    address  3FTDu61ozveWW7P2xg9a51wLZ5WQ1Szfrt
  • 63a76a570bc9fd21a923eaba85b3a3d97d1173bbfe62fbeea16c773222bfe64f:1
  • value  5998452
    address  3BJDTDrxWC5SSJDY2GnuGVHJL1kUz9RfKN